About This Listing

The Jack Casady Signature Bass was designed by Rock and Roll Hall of Fame legend Jack Casady and is the culmination of years of experimentation by the Jefferson Airplane and Hot Tuna bassist to find an instrument with superior electric tone and the response of an acoustic bass. Featuring the Casady-designed JCB low-impedance pickup and a three-position rotary impedance control for a wide range of tonal versatility.

Product Overview
A collaborative effort between Jefferson Airplane's Jack Casady and Epiphone, the Epiphone Jack Casady Signature Bass takes after its short-lived cousin, the Les Paul Signature Bass. Like its predecessor of the '70s, the Jack Casady Signature Bass has just one low-impedance humbucker, along with an impedance control knob. The creation of this unique semi-hollow bass was actually spurred on by Casady himself, who approached Epiphone with his design ideas.
